The telehandler earns its place on Abu Dhabi sites where a forklift runs out of reach and a crane is more machine than the job needs: placing blocks on a second lift, feeding steel to an erection crew, landing materials over an obstruction, or working storage on rough, part-prepared ground. This guide sets out when the telehandler is the right call in Abu Dhabi and what a complete enquiry looks like.

Telehandler vs forklift
A forklift lifts vertically above its own footprint; a telehandler adds a telescopic boom that reaches forward and up. If every load ends at truck-bed or ground level, a forklift — possibly a rough-terrain forklift — is cheaper. The moment loads must land beyond where the machine can drive, or above forklift mast heights, the telehandler takes over.
Telehandler vs crane
Telehandlers shine on repetitive placement work with moderate weights and heights. Single heavy lifts, long radii and engineered picks belong to a mobile crane. A practical boundary: when the load chart conversation starts involving outriggers and lift plans, you have left telehandler territory.

Lift-height and attachment planning
Send three numbers: the weight of the heaviest load, the height it must land at, and the forward distance from where the machine can stand. Attachments — forks, buckets and jibs where available — should be requested at booking so they arrive fitted. Surface condition matters too: telehandlers handle rough ground well, but soft sand after watering deserves a mention.

FAQs
What reach do common telehandlers offer?
Market classes commonly span roughly 12 to 20 metres of lift height with proportional forward reach — send your numbers and the class is matched for you.
Is an operator included?
Operated hire is standard and expected on managed Abu Dhabi sites; certification is part of the package.
